The Importance of Effective Hospital Supply and Equipment Management
In today's healthcare landscape, hospitals are under immense pressure to deliver high-quality care while controlling costs. One area where hospitals can make significant improvements is in their supply and equipment management systems. Proper management of supplies and equipment is crucial for ensuring that patients receive the best care possible, while also minimizing waste and reducing expenses.
Effective supply and equipment management can help hospitals:
- Optimize inventory levels to ensure that essential supplies are always available when needed.
- Minimize waste and reduce costs by efficiently tracking and managing supplies and equipment.
- Improve patient outcomes by ensuring that medical devices and equipment are in good working order.
The Role of Wearable Technology in Supply and Equipment Management
Wearable technology, such as smartwatches and fitness trackers, has become increasingly popular in recent years. These devices can collect a wealth of data, including information on physical activity, heart rate, sleep patterns, and more. This data can provide valuable insights into an individual's health and wellness, but it can also be used to improve supply and equipment management in hospitals.
Benefits of Incorporating Wearable Technology Data
By incorporating wearable technology data into their supply and equipment management systems, hospitals can gain access to real-time information that can help them make more informed decisions. Some of the key benefits of using wearable technology data in hospital management include:
- Real-time insights into inventory levels and equipment usage.
- Identification of trends and patterns in patient data to improve care.
- Streamlined operations and reduced costs through better decision-making.
Challenges of Incorporating Wearable Technology Data
While the benefits of using wearable technology data in supply and equipment management are clear, there are also challenges that hospitals must overcome. Some of the key challenges include:
- Ensuring data accuracy and reliability.
- Integrating wearable technology data into existing management systems.
- Protecting patient privacy and maintaining data security.
Strategies for Incorporating Wearable Technology Data
Despite these challenges, hospitals can take several steps to effectively incorporate wearable technology data into their supply and equipment management systems. Some key strategies include:
- Implementing data analytics tools to process and analyze wearable technology data.
- Integrating wearable technology data with existing electronic health record systems.
- Training staff on how to interpret and use wearable technology data effectively.
By following these strategies, hospitals can harness the power of wearable technology data to improve their supply and equipment management systems, ultimately leading to better patient care and reduced costs.
